什么是V2Ray?
V2Ray是一个功能强大的网络代理工具,旨在帮助用户突破互联网限制,保护用户隐私。它支持多种传输协议和多种代理方式,使其成为网络自由的首选解决方案。
V2Ray的主要特性
- 多协议支持:支持VMess、VLess、Shadowsocks等多种协议。
- 灵活的路由:支持动态路由和自定义规则,以适应不同的网络环境。
- 隐蔽性:提供多种加密和混淆方式,提高隐私保护。
macOS上安装V2Ray的步骤
1. 下载V2Ray
首先,访问V2Ray的官方网站或其GitHub页面下载最新版本的V2Ray。
2. 解压文件
下载完成后,将压缩文件解压到您选择的目录。可以通过以下命令解压: bash unzip v2ray-linux-64.zip
3. 移动到系统路径
为了方便使用,将解压后的文件移动到系统路径下: bash sudo mv v2ray /usr/local/bin/
sudo mv v2ctl /usr/local/bin/
4. 配置V2Ray
配置文件位于解压目录下的config.json文件。您需要根据您的网络环境进行调整。
- 修改服务器地址和端口
- 选择合适的传输协议
5. 启动V2Ray
在终端中使用以下命令启动V2Ray: bash v2ray -config /path/to/config.json
V2Ray的使用方法
1. 配置代理
在macOS的网络设置中,配置HTTP或SOCKS代理,使用V2Ray的本地监听端口。
2. 使用客户端
可以使用各种V2Ray客户端(如V2RayX)来简化使用,提供图形界面。
V2Ray的常见问题
Q1: V2Ray能在macOS上运行吗?
A: 是的,V2Ray可以在macOS上运行。只需按照上述安装步骤进行配置即可。
Q2: 如何配置V2Ray的代理?
A: 在macOS的网络设置中,将代理设置为使用V2Ray的本地端口,具体端口请查看config.json文件中的配置。
Q3: V2Ray和Shadowsocks有什么区别?
A: V2Ray支持多种协议和灵活的路由功能,相对Shadowsocks更加灵活和强大。Shadowsocks是一种特定的代理协议,而V2Ray则是一个框架,支持多种协议和插件。
Q4: 如何查看V2Ray的运行状态?
A: 在终端中查看V2Ray的日志信息,您可以使用命令:
bash cat /path/to/log/file.log
检查任何错误信息或运行状态。
总结
在macOS上安装和使用V2Ray并不复杂,只需按照上述步骤进行配置和调整,您就可以享受自由的互联网。V2Ray的强大功能和灵活性使其成为网络代理的理想选择。